Such, Such Were the Joys

Reflecting on his childhood education at a strict English preparatory school, George Orwell delves into the harsh realities and lasting scars of an oppressive system. In Such, Such Were the Joys, he lays bare the cruelty and class prejudice embedded in the British educational system, exploring how early experiences of injustice shape one’s understanding of authority and morality. With his characteristic clarity and unflinching honesty, Orwell offers a compelling critique of the institutions that mold society's future.

GEORGE ORWELL was born in India in 1903 and passed away in London in 1950. As a journalist, critic, and author, he was a sharp commentator on his era and its political conditions and consequences.
